Gayton Open Gardens
Gayton, north of Towcester, Northamptonshire Sunday 7th June 2026 1.00pm to 5.00pm
Gayton is a small pretty village on a hill between Northampton and Towcester and has been running Open Gardens for many years.
The village has a wide variety of garden styles to give inspiration and enjoyment to our visitors.
This year we have two gardens that are new to our event, two allotments will be open along with the school allotment and the village Spinney. For younger visitors we run a Teddy bear trail with a prize for all bear names found.
There are afternoon teas in the village church with home make cakes and scones.
Proceeds: All proceeds go to help with upkeep of our village church.
Plant sales: There is a plant stall located in the church with plants grown by our gardeners.
